NetJson ✉️

What is NetJson

NetJson is a binary representation format of JSON. It supports additional types like BigInts and binary data (in the form of ArrayBuffers). It was designed to be super small (Much fewer bytes than usual JSON string encoding). But keep in mind that encoding and decoding are way slower than JSON.stringify and parse. Because NetJson is entirely written in typescript and the native JSON string encoding and decoding are heavily optimized in V8.

How to use NetJson

import NetJson from "netjson";

const player = {
    name: "P1",
    position: [10,23,53],
    avatar: new ArrayBuffer(1000),
    score: BigInt(200),
    items: [{name: "HealPotion", price: 200},{name: "PowerPotion", price: 120}]
}
const encodedPlayerBinary = NetJson.encode(player);
const decodedPlayer = NetJson.decode(encodedPlayerBinary);

Comparison to JSON.stringify/parse

On a MacBook Air M1, in Node.js Version: 16.13.0 LTS.

Comparison - 1

Data:

[{
    name: "SomePerson",
    age: 30,
    cars: [],
    hobbies: ["Programming","Football"],
    dev: true
},{
    name: "SomePerson2",
    age: 24,
    cars: [
        {
            model: "MX1",
            color: "black",
            horsepower: 200,
            maxSpeed: 230
        }
    ],
    hobbies: ["Music","Cars"],
    dev: false
}];

Results:

Encode

  • NetJson.encode: Bytes: 186, Time: 0.311 ms
  • JSON.stringify: Bytes: 234, Time: 0.005 ms

Decode

  • NetJson.decode: Time: 0.329 ms
  • JSON.parse: Time: 0.005 ms

Comparison - 2

Data:

Array.from({ length: 10000 }, (_, id) => ({
    id,
    coordinates: Array.from({ length: 3 }, () =>
        Math.trunc(Math.random() * 1000000000)
    ),
    healthy: Math.random() > 0.5,
    power: Math.floor(Math.random() * 101),
    errors: [],
}));

Results:

Encode

  • NetJson.encode: Bytes: 639.745, Time: 20.443 ms
  • JSON.stringify: Bytes: 959.730, Time: 3.377 ms

Decode

  • NetJson.decode: Time: 49.657 ms
  • JSON.parse: Time: 3.148 ms
